How To Perform Tests

NOTE: Test procedures require Breakout Box (007-00033) and ABS Adapter (007-00115).
  1. DO NOT perform any test unless instructed to do so. Follow each test step in order until fault is found. DO NOT replace any part unless directed to do so. When more than one code is retrieved, start with first code displayed.
  2. DO NOT measure voltage or resistance at ABS control module unless instructed to do so. DO NOT connect any test light unless specified in testing procedure. All measurements are made by probing rear of connector (wiring harness side). Isolate both ends of circuit and turn ignition off when checking for short or open, unless instructed otherwise.
  3. After each repair, verify all components are properly reconnected, then clear codes. See CLEARING TROUBLE CODES .
